What to check before buying

The 60Hz panel is a weaker fit for premium console gaming. HDR impact will be more limited than on brighter Mini LED or OLED rivals. Built-in speakers are unlikely to match the size of the picture. These are decision points, not footnotes: if one describes the buyer's main concern, a different 65-inch television may be the safer choice.
